r+s/2
For r = 13 and s = 11

Answer:

18.5

Step-by-step explanation:

Plug in 13 for r, and 11 for s in the expression.

r + s/2 = 13 + 11/2

Remember to follow PEMDAS.

PEMDAS is the order of operation, and =

Parenthesis

Exponents (& Roots)

Multiplication

Division

Addition

Subtraction

First, divide:

11/2 = 5.5

Next, add:

5.5 + 13 = 18.5

18.5 is your answer.
